An exclusive opportunity to purchase a delightful 12 bedroom boutique hotel situated in the picturesque and peaceful mountain region of Penáguila, enjoying 360° spectacular panoramic views.
Originally built in 1890 as a hunting lodge, La Escondida is set in 210 acres of land and has additional outbuildings including Torre Sena which is a castellated part developed building, an owners two bedroom villa, a large agricultural building and three derelict farmhouses, all ideal for extensive development subject to local planning permissions.
La Escondida can be reached from Alicante airport in approximately 45 minutes on the Alicante to Alcoy motorway making it easily accessible.
Alicante airport has the benefit of year round chartered and scheduled flights to many national and European destinations. Flights times from London are within 2 hours 30 minutes.
This stunning hotel was converted and refurbished approximately 10 years ago by a British couple, Terry and Yvette Venables, who have lovingly created a delightful environment.

Torre Sena - Fronting the site of La Escondida this period vacant building dates back from 12/13th Century, with some sympathetic modifications over time. The stunning tower still remains intact and makes one of a trio of towers within the immediate area.
Subject to planning permission the redevelopment could include, ground floor function rooms including additional bar/restaurant, 6 first floor bedrooms and 4 or 6 second floor bedrooms.
The roof has potential to be redeveloped to have balconies/terraces incorporated within the top floor bedrooms which would enjoy panoramic views.
Torre Sena could also be converted into a stunning Health or Leisure Spa subject to planning permission.

The Location - The drive to La Escondida gives the first clues of being on the way to a special place. La Escondida is located in the Valencian Community, between the municipalities of Benifallim and Penáguila, 20 minutes from the town of Alcoy and at the gates of Font Roja National Park.
